Freddy Adu Relates to Gio Reyna’s Club Struggles

Freddy Adu’s perspective sheds new light on Gio Reyna’s club struggles, drawing a compelling parallel between two of the most-discussed American soccer journeys in recent memory. The former United States men’s national team (USMNT) prodigy, once hailed as the future of American soccer, has publicly empathized with Reyna’s current situation in Germany, highlighting both the unique pressures and recurring challenges faced by young talents in the international game.

Freddy Adu Reflects on Gio Reyna’s Ongoing Club Struggles

Freddy Adu’s own professional path was marked by early acclaim and significant expectations, similar to Gio Reyna’s rise in European football. In recent comments, Adu noted, “I do feel for him,” recognizing the weight of anticipation that can quickly shift to scrutiny when opportunities become limited at the club level. For Reyna, currently battling for more playing time amid swirling transfer rumors, the situation is especially acute at Borussia Dortmund, where competition for midfield spots remains fierce.

Parallels in Pressure and Opportunity

Both Adu and Reyna experienced precocious breakthroughs—Adu with DC United as a teenager, Reyna in a starring role at Dortmund—but Adu warns that the modern game’s spotlight is even more intense. Visible frustration, he explains, can sometimes diminish a young player’s appeal to coaches and scouts. “When every minute is dissected, and every emotion is broadcast, it can feel like there’s no room for error,” Adu shared. He stressed the importance of managing public perception and personal composure, as negative body language or outbursts can inadvertently limit future opportunities.

Club Struggles and the Cycle of Limited Minutes

Freddy Adu’s insights on Reyna’s club struggles point to a damaging cycle that many young players face: reduced playing time leads to frustration, which impacts confidence and on-field performance. This cycle is difficult to break without support from coaching staff and a resilient mindset. Adu recalls similar challenges from his playing days, when he found himself on the bench more often than he would have liked. “It’s easy to let frustration take over, but staying focused on improvement is crucial,” he advised.

The Impact on Development and Transfer Speculation

The possibility of a transfer for Gio Reyna remains a constant topic of discussion, with clubs across Europe reportedly interested in his services. Adu believes a move could offer a fresh start and renewed confidence, provided Reyna finds an environment that prioritizes his development. “Sometimes, a change of scenery is what a player needs to unlock potential,” Adu noted. He also highlighted the importance of choosing a club that is committed to nurturing young talent rather than just acquiring another asset.

The USMNT Connection: Lessons for Reyna and Future Stars

Adu’s empathy for Reyna extends beyond club football to the national team setup. Both have been seen as future cornerstones for the USMNT, but Adu’s career serves as a cautionary tale about the volatility of early hype. “The path is never linear,” Adu reflected, urging patience from both fans and players alike. He advocates for a support system that provides guidance when things don’t go as planned and encourages young talents to focus on long-term growth rather than immediate stardom.
